Agriculture Businesses in THATCHER, IDAHO

There are 3 Agriculture businesses listed under 1 Agriculture categories in Thatcher, Idaho. Please select a category or business from the list below to view phone numbers, directions, ratings, and more.

Spring Creek Ranch
15852 North Highway 34
Trout Creek Ranch Inc
3 East Trout Creek Road
Williams Wheeler Ranches Llc
14712 North Highway 34